Nintendo Switch 2 has become one of the most anticipated consoles of the year, but few people know that work on it began in 2019 - just two years after the release of the original Switch. Court documents in the Nintendo v. Genki case revealed how the company was preparing the next generation of the console step by step, which will go on sale on 5 June for $450.

The Louvre in Paris is ending the era of the unique audio guide based on the Nintendo 3DS, which has helped millions of visitors discover masterpieces of world art for over a decade. From September 2025, this service will cease to operate, and a new system will take its place, the details of which are still being kept secret.

Nintendo has officially filed a lawsuit against accessory manufacturer Genki, accusing the company of trademark infringement, unfair competition, and false advertising. The reason for this was Genki's demonstration of Nintendo Switch 2 mock-ups and statements about the compatibility of its accessories with the new console before its official announcement.

Nintendo is not going to let the large-scale Pokemon data breach that occurred in October 2024 go unchallenged and is taking decisive steps to identify the culprit. The company has filed a lawsuit in California seeking a subpoena against Discord, which, if approved, would require the platform to reveal the identity of Teraleak, the nickname Pokemon fans gave to the person behind the massive data breach.
